Classic Spanish Sangria Recipe
Sangria (Spanish: sangría; Portuguese: sangria) is a wine punch typical served in Spain and Portugal (the word means “bloody” in both languages).
Sangria (Spanish: sangría; Portuguese: sangria) is a wine punch typical served in Spain and Portugal (the word means “bloody” in both languages).
Recent Comments